We bought our tickets then boarded this huuuge boat on the river Spree. It is a pretty awesome river, I have to say. The captain of the boat was this odd old man who was a caricature of a captain. It was really great. The boat tour was 1 hour long and it was beautiful. We got to see the old and the new parts of Berlin. At one point in the river there are white crosses symbolizing the deaths of the people who tried to flee East Germany by swimming across the river. Sadness.

When the river tour was over we went to a beach bar! The river doesn't have sandy beaches but all over Berlin they have created these little restaurant things with sand on the ground and palm trees where one can go and drink and be merry. It was SO HOT! I'm sunburned! But I don't really mind!
